At TC 0025 FILD, we drive safety, compliancy, quality, sustainability, and commonality in fluid pressure systems. As the knowledge center within the MC Cluster, we define system requirements, influence standards and legislation, and promote adherence and accessibility of knowledge across the organization. Our ambition is to elevate project teams to a maturity level where they can confidently apply our expertise and tools to deliver safe and compliant fluid pressure systems.
You will support the FILD Competence Team and Design automation project in strengthening the maturity and standardization of mechanical routing within fluid pressure systems. Your focus will be on developing workflows, documentation structures, and roll‑out approaches that help designers, architects, and project teams consistently apply mechanical routing guidelines. This includes shaping processes that enhance the accessibility, usability, and adoption of routing‑related design rules. Your main responsibilities will be:
Contribute to the creation and improvement of processes/capabilities of developed mechanical routing features, including routing principles, best practices, and integration guidelines.
Support the development of version controlled improvements, publication workflows, and a user‑friendly documentation.
Structure and maintain routing‑specific documentation for end‑users—mechanical designers, architects, project teams, and supplier‑facing roles—ensuring clarity, usability, and consistent application of routing standards.
Define end‑to‑end workflows that ensure routing documentation is not only reviewed but also communicated, understood, and adopted by downstream engineering teams.
Define workflows that ensure routing documentation is properly communicated, understood, and applied by designers and engineers.
Collaborate closely with FILD engineers to ensure routing documentation and workflows align with competence goals and system‑level requirements.
Work with stakeholders involved in mechanical routing to co‑develop an effective solution and roll‑out strategy.
Provide structured input that improves internal routing workflows and strengthens the accessibility of mechanical routing knowledge across projects.
This is a bachelor or master (non-thesis) internship for minimum 6 months, minimum 3 days per week (1-3 days on-site). The start date of this internship is around February 2026.
To be suitable for the internship, you:
Have a background in Engineering, Computer Science, Data Science, or related;
Possess solid organizational and analytical skills;
Have an interest in engineering documentation, process design, and internal tooling;
Are proactive and capable of working both independently and collaboratively;
Have experience or interest in process development, workflow design or technical background in fluid systems design (preferred but not required);
Possess great communication skills in English, both written and verbally.
